Juventus striker Alessandro Del Piero has sent get well wishes to on-loan AC Milan midfielder David Beckham following his devastating injury.

‘Becks’ ruptured his left Achilles tendon while playing for the Rossoneri last weekend and faces up to six months on the sidelines after going under the knife.

“I’m really sorry for what unfortunately happened to him,” Del Piero told Mediaset.

“With the World Cup just two months away and in the thick of the title race, it’s really tough to come to terms with such an injury which suddenly takes it all away.

“I’m particularly sorry for him because I know him very well. He is a good lad, a big professional.

“Dear David, I’m sure you will overcome this challenge too. Good luck. We’ll meet again on the pitch.”
